TEXT OF READING 4066-1 M 57
Text
Date: 4/17/1944 Sex: M Age: 57 ReadingID: 11762
This Psychic Reading given by Edgar Cayce at the office of the Association, Arctic Crescent, Virginia Beach, Va., this 17th day of April, 1944, in accordance with request made by the wife - Mrs. […], new Associate Member of the Ass”n for Research & Enlightenment, Inc.
[Edgar Cayce; Gertrude Cayce, Conductor; Gladys Davis, Steno. (Notes read to and transcribed by Jeanette Fitch.)]
Time of Reading Set bet. 10:30 and 11:30 A. M. Taken 10:40 to 10:50 A. M. Eastern War Time. …, Oregon.
-
GC: You will go over this body carefully, examine it thoroughly, and tell me the conditions you find at the present time; giving the cause of the existing conditions, also suggestions for help and relief of this body; answering the questions, as I ask them:
-
EC: Nabisco - yes - unless they do something rather soon for this body, we will find the heart block or the arterial block will cause a stroke. For there are clots.
-
Unless the body keeps quiet, and keeps off of the feet most of the time, these conditions will be rather serious - even in the use of these things we will suggest for the body.
-
Don’t take sedatives unless it is necessary. But those that will keep the heart better in its activities are well, administered only under the direction of a physician who will be in accord with those things suggested here; else the quantities may cause more damage than help. Rather than strychnine, then, that would dilate the heart, we would advise just the opposite - that causes the pumping of the heart, or the drawing of the circulation through.
-
But do take eliminants, mineral salts; such as, in the combinations of Eno Salts or Sal Hepatica; small doses two or three times a day until there is the entire elimination of the poisons that accumulate in a dilated colon, all the way across the transverse colon. Take a level teaspoonful of the Sal Hepatica, or the Eno Salts, two or three times a day, for two or three days.
-
Then have a colonic irrigation.
-
Each evening before the body retires, have a thorough massage using cocoa butter as a means to stimulate superficial circulation. Rub from the tips of the toes, the tips of hands, and the top of the head, towards the central portion of the body. Keep these regularly.
-
Do not have heavy foods. Liquids or semi-liquids are preferable.
-
Doing these we may bring bettered conditions for the body.
-
Ready for questions.
-
(Q) How long will he be able to carry on in business? (A) Unless something is done pretty soon, he won’t be able to carry on very long!
-
(Q) Is there any hope of a cure? (A) While there’s life there’s hope, but there must be persistence, consistence and faith in the divine, that the entity has a purposefulness in its experience in the earth.
-
(Q) Is the trouble all in the clogging of the arteries? (A) This is a result not the cause. The more of the trouble is in the overengorgement of the body, the lack of proper activities and the colon condition. Do, though, as indicated and we will bring help for the body.
-
We are through with this reading.

R4. 7/28/50 Questionnaire - 8/21/50 Wife’s reply:
Age at date of reading: 57 Sex: M
Date of Reading: April 17th, 1944
Chief Complaint: Heart condition - Milk-leg, then Bergers disease. Letter 3/29/44:- He has had 2 very bad heart attacks about three years ago - about a year apart.
Date of Onset: Duration: Reoccurrence: Intensity: Physician’s Diagnosis and Treatment:
The first about three years ago the doctors said was Angina. Then a year ago he developed what they called milk-leg. The swelling has now been greatly reduced and the doctors seem to think the trouble is all in the arteries. Not hardening
- but a clogging of the arteries - first in the swollen leg, now in the other leg, beginning at the feet. Cannot be on feet any length of time. Considerable pain. Walk with cane, very lame.
Physicians’ Diagnosis and treatment: Readings’ Diagnosis:- Heart block or arterial block, may cause stroke?
Reading’s Recommendations: Keep body quiet, off feet most of time. DON’T take sedatives unless necessary - then then under the direction of physician who will be in accord with suggestions given here. RATHER THAN STRYCHNINE that would dilate heart, advise opposite that cause pumping of heart to draw circulation through. TAKE eliminants, mineral salts, Eno Salts, Sal Hepatica - small doses - then have colonic irrigation. Massage using cocoa butter, stimulate superficial circulation. Massage toward body.
Duration of Treatment: No. of years: 4 Months: …
Results of Treatment: Cured: … Relief: X Failure: …
At the end of 1 year: Kept off feet & followed other directions with exception of massage - Dr. advised against it - Stroke at 3rd yr, but recovered.
Date: 8/21/50 Signed: [4066]‘s wife (Patient, Parent, or Guardian)
Note: Please give name and address of any physician who helped you carry out your reading.
We are most anxious to have a complete and detailed report on the manner in which your husband’s reading was carried out. Please indicate specifically the results he experienced as the treatment progressed. Others suffering from conditions similar may benefit through our research making the results available.
Do you have any explanation for the word “Nabisco” at the beginning of the reading? A. A childhood nick-name, I felt Mr. [4066]‘s life was prolonged and made more endurable by the above treatment.
Mr. [4066] passed away July 1, 1948.
Acute diabetes - he was ill only two days.
R5. 10/10/52 D. H. Fogel, M.D.’s Comment: “This case should definitely be indexed under coronary thrombosis.”

B1. 3/29/44 Wife’s letter:
Association for Research and Enlightenment Virginia Beach, Virginia
Dear Folks:
In regards to my request for a physical reading from Mr. Cayce for my husband, [4066], which you dated for the morning of April 17th at 10:30 to 11:30, I will state his case as near as I can. He has had two very bad heart attacks about a year apart. The first about three years ago that the doctors said was angina. Then about a year ago he developed what they called a Milk-leg. The swelling has now been greatly reduced and the doctors seem to think the trouble is all in the arteries. Not hardening of the arteries but a clogging. First in the swollen leg and now starting in the other leg - beginning at the foot. He can not be on his feet any length of time. He is in considerable pain. He can walk with a cane but is very lame.
I feel sure your help will solve this problem and I am most anxious for your report. I shall reserve the appointed time for prayer.
Sincerely, [4066]
